Meaning of "stereochemistry"

Stereochemistry (noun) - the branch of chemistry that deals with the three-dimensional arrangement of atoms within molecules

  • the branch of chemistry that involves the spatial arrangement of the atoms of molecules, and studies how this affects the physical and chemical properties of such species
  • the effect of such spatial arrangement on the chemistry of a particular compound
